In a thrilling match between Rio Ave and FC Vizela in the Portuguese Primeira Liga, Ghanaian sensation Abdul Aziz Yakubu showcased his prowess on Saturday, securing a goal for his team. The game, which ended in a 1-1 draw, saw Yakubu shine brightly.
Taking to the field for Rio Ave in Round 31, Yakubu’s performance was nothing short of stellar. With just four minutes into the game, he found the back of the net with a composed finish, courtesy of a well-timed pass from teammate Umaro Embalo.
However, despite Yakubu’s early goal, Rio Ave couldn’t maintain their lead as FC Vizela fought back valiantly. In the 67th minute, Samuel Essende leveled the score for Vizela, setting the stage for a tense second half.
Both teams battled fiercely, creating numerous opportunities, but neither could break the deadlock. As the final whistle blew, the score remained tied, with each team earning a point.
Yakubu’s goal showcased his talent, bringing his tally to six goals and one assist in 16 league appearances for Rio Ave. His performance continues to highlight his importance to the team and his growing influence in the league.
